Какие файловые системы имеют первоклассную поддержку как в Linux, так и в Mac OS X

Какие файловые системы имеют первоклассную поддержку как в Linux, так и в Mac OS X

Возможный дубликат:
Какую файловую систему использовать между OSX и Linux

Я заменяю оптический привод на Macbook на HDD и планирую использовать половину нового диска для Linux. Другую половину я хочу использовать для хранения, к которому и Linux, и Mac OS должны иметь доступ.

Какую файловую систему вы рекомендуете использовать?

решение1

Поддержка OSX (для доступа на чтение/запись без специальных обходных путей)

  • HFS плюс
  • УФС
  • ФАТ-32
  • ФАТ-16

Linux поддерживает FAT-32 и FAT-16. Поддержка UFS, похоже, не универсальна (или, возможно, UFS несколько различается в разных реализациях операционных систем). Я думаю, что Linux также поддерживает HFS plus, но вам нужно отключить журналирование, и могут возникнуть другие проблемы.

Поэтому я бы использовал FAT-32

решение2

Я предполагаю, что когда вы говорите «доступ», вы имеете в виду и чтение, и запись, и вы, вероятно, хотите иметь возможность устанавливать разрешения и делать все остальное, что вы можете делать на своем обычном жестком диске.
Linux поддерживает больше файловых систем, чем OSX, но перекрытие меньше, чем вы могли бы подумать.

Файловые системы, которые OSX «официально» поддерживает:
UFS HFS+ FAT 16 и 32

Linux на самом деле не совместим с UFS. Хотя онявляетсясовместим с HFS+, вам придется пожертвовать стабильностью ради этого. FAT32 не чувствительна к регистру, что является повседневной проблемой для пользователей OSX и Linux, которые привыкли к тому, что она чувствительна к регистру. В ней также отсутствует ряд функций, которые есть у современных файловых систем, таких как символические ссылки и журналирование.
Я бы рекомендовал ext3. Это файловая система по умолчанию для довольно большого количества дистрибутивов Linux на некоторое время, и она также совместима с OSX.

Связанный контент